Pennsylvania AG discusses Shapiro/Trump lawsuit on This Week in Pennsylvania

(WHTM) — Last week, Pennsylvania Governor Josh Shapiro (D) sued the Trump administration after about $2 billion in federal funds was frozen. Many asked why Shapiro, a former Attorney General, was leading the charge and not the newly elected Attorney General Dave Sunday (R).

Sunday joined This Week in Pennsylvania to discuss the issue and other priorities after his first month in office.

“Oftentimes, the greatest results come through negotiation and not through just filing a lawsuit and that’s very important for people to understand,” Sunday said. “As Attorney General, what you will not see out of me is an incident happens, and then the very next day I file a lawsuit solely—and I’m not saying that’s the case here—but to get a media hit, and those lawsuits may not even turn into actual positive outcomes for anyone.”

House Republican Chair of the Appropriations Committee Representative Jim Struzzi and Democrat Appropriations Chair Jordan Harris also joined the show to discuss the governor’s recent budget address.
